        Are you going on a trip? If you are feeding your fish every day or more, than you are over feeding. Excessive food makes for high ammonia levels, the higher those levels are the dirtier your tank is and then your fish die. Also you dont need to change your filter once a week, once a month, or even once every six months. As long as water is flowing through your filter and you are changing your charcoal you should be good to go. Helpful bacteria grows in that filter and helps neutralize the ammonia levels.

        People will tell you otherwise though...
